North Queensland Conservation Council (NQCC) is a peak organisation in the Statewide environmental movement and the voice for the environment in North Queensland. It represents the area roughly bounded by Bowen in the south, Cardwell in the north, the Coral Sea in the east and the Northern Territory border in the west, advocating on regional issues. NQCC is an umbrella group, aiming to support small, often single-issue and hands-on, local organisations in statewide forums. NQCC promotes ‘the conservation cause’ by undertaking targeted media and action campaigns, advocating on behalf of the environment in relation to specific development proposals and legislation, and, importantly, working to raise public awareness. Through a range of activities, NQCC: - represents the region within the Statewide conservation movement; - promotes and protects the values of the natural environment of north Queensland; - furthers the protection and rehabilitation of the environment through advocacy and education; - ensures that resource use and development in the region occurs in an ecologically sustainable manner and respects species, habitats and the integrity of ecosystems; - collaborates with and, where possible, assist organisations and individuals working toward environmental conservation within the region; and - works with governments to ensure that legislation, regulations and policies are designed and implemented to protect the values of the natural environment of north Queensland.
